If there was one standout trend at the Las Vegas shows, it was an earring story. Think climbers, studs, cuffs, jackets, front-to-backs, and skirts (jackets that hang down behind the ear to give the appearance of the garment). So the new Flying V ear studs made to be worn at a 45-degree angle on the ear—as if they were climbing—from EF Collection fits right in with the trend of the moment.
I love the look in all three colors of 14k gold (white, rose, and yellow), as a pair or a single—which the firm will start selling in the fall—in a second piercing. With 0.16 ct. t.w. diamonds, a pair retails for $695.
